IT is well known that the Forest and Stream has offered a valuable piece of plate as a prize for an intercollegiate rifle-match. From the columns of that journal we learn that many colleges have taken hold of the subject energetically, and their rifle-clubs are looking around among their graduates for suitable men to coach them. Columbia claims Colonel Gildersleeve, and Williams will probably call on Mr. Orange Judd. The Forest and Stream also offers "to a college rifle-club, a member of which will furnish us with the best appropriate design for a vase or shield, a gold badge, to be shot for among themselves: said design to be engraved and printed in this paper as soon as accepted, due credit being given to the designer."
